To add a Capital One SavorOne authorized user, log in to your online account and click the “I Want To...” tab, or call customer service at the number on the back of your card. You will need to provide the person's full name, phone number, date of birth, and Social Security number to add them as an authorized user.
A primary cardholder can make anyone a Capital One SavorOne authorized user, as there are no minimum age requirements.
How to Add a Capital One SavorOne Authorized User Online
- Log in to your Capital One SavorOne card account.
- Click the “I Want To...” tab.
- Click “Add New User” under the “Manage Account Users” menu.
- Choose whether the user will be an Account Manager with full login access, or an Authorized User with limited access.
- Enter the user’s full name, phone number, date of birth, and Social Security number.
- Click “Continue.”
When you add a Capital One SavorOne authorized user, they will receive their own credit card, sent to your mailing address, within 7-10 business days of being added to the account. The authorized user’s credit card will be linked to your account and will have full access to the account’s credit limit. Capital One authorized users are able to make purchases and earn rewards. However, they cannot track purchases, report issues, redeem rewards, or close accounts.
In addition, any purchases an authorized user makes on the account will appear on your statement, and as the primary cardholder, you are responsible for all purchases on the account. Capital One reports account information to all three of the major credit bureaus, which affects not only the user’s credit history, but also the primary cardholder’s. Authorized users may be removed from an account at the user’s or primary cardholder’s request at any time, and for any reason.

You can add anyone as a Capital One SavorOne authorized user, regardless of age or credit standing. You will need the person's name, phone number and birthdate in order to add them. Once you have the required info, either log in to your online account or call customer service at 1 (877) 338-4802 to begin. If you're adding an authorized user online, once logged in, click "Services" and "Manage Authorized Users." Then, click the green "Add New User" button. By phone, state "add an authorized user" when prompted. No matter which method you use, there are a few things you should know before you decide to add an authorized user to your SavorOne card.
For starters, there's no limit to the number of authorized users you can add. Each authorized user will have a SavorOne card in their name and will share your account's available credit limit. Authorized users can make purchases, check account information and report lost or stolen cards. However, they cannot negotiate account terms or add other authorized users. Only the primary cardholder can add authorized users to an account. As the primary cardholder, you can also set spending limits for each authorized user. You're also responsible for paying for all purchases any authorized user charges to your account.
